The decision of the All Progressives Congress (APC) National Legal adviser, Dr. Muiz Banire to step aside until the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C) conclude its investigation on an allegation of bribery against him is concluded is uncommon and plausible.

In a statement in Ilorin on Tuesday, the Organising Secretary of the group, Joe Mahmud said this should be a standard for any citizen under investigation. "Dr. Muiz Banire is quitting his plum office as a national legal adviser of a ruling party and a privileged position as a member of the electoral reform committee so that, the investigators will not be intimidated and those positions he occupied will not be brought into disrepute.

" For whatever reason he is put under investigation, he has not accused anyone of maligning him or went on campaign of sentiments. He is facing the facts of the charges against him.

"Dr. Banire is an exceptional breed and a first class Nigerian that has opened a new page in our national life. His action will teach our leaders some lessons that may be useful to really transform this country and take us out of such corrupt entities in the world."

Dr. Banire according to the statement could have been crying of 'witch haunting, wizard haunting or politically motivated trial', as it is the case of some high profile criminal trials in the country today.

"He could have suffocated the media with noise of witch haunting, wizard haunting or say it is politically motivated as the case may be to whip up sentiments and curry the favor of the public, leaving out the substance in the allegations.

" What do we have today? Politicians going to courts with government vehicles with official number plates on them. On many occasions with police and other security escorts and swamp of lawyers. They are not only displaying strength but also out to intimidate the learned trial judge.".

The statement concluded that, "our consolation is that , should all of us cooperate to shied the corrupt elements in our midst, none of them will evade the coming wrath of the Creator of the poor masses that have for long been deprived of good living standards occasioned by their corrupt practices".
